Abstract

Parsonage-Turner syndrome (PTS) is a rare brachial plexus neuropathy with a sudden onset of upper extremity pain, weakness, and loss of range of motion (ROM). Studies on occupational therapy (OT) interventions are limited. The aim of this case report was to explore the OT experiences, interventions, and outcomes of a patient with PTS. The patient was a 44-year-old woman with COVID-19 who was admitted to the intensive care unit (ICU). She was intubated and placed in the prone position for 16 hours a day. The diagnosis of PTS was confirmed. Data included the OT medical record and interviews with the patient and the treating occupational therapist. The OT intervention type and frequency are reported. Outcome measurements showed 80-100% improvement for the affected left upper extremity (LUE). Manual muscle testing scores returned to WNL except for shoulder internal and external rotation, with improved but limited grip, pinch, and fine motor coordination. The qualitative data emphasized the importance of considering the sociocultural perspective and psychosocial effects of PTS with OT interventions. This study reported the OT interventions and outcomes of this rare condition. All outcome measures demonstrated improvement, many within normal limits. Considering the sociocultural and psychosocial effects of the patient appeared to contribute to improved outcomes.

摘要

帕森奇-特纳综合征(PTS)是一种罕见的臂丛神经病,其特征为上肢突然出现疼痛、无力及活动范围(ROM)丧失。关于职业治疗(OT)干预的研究有限。本病例报告的目的是探讨一名PTS患者的OT经历、干预措施及结果。该患者是一名44岁的感染新冠病毒的女性,被收入重症监护病房(ICU)。她接受了插管,并每天俯卧16小时。PTS诊断得到证实。数据包括OT病历以及对患者和主治职业治疗师的访谈。报告了OT干预类型和频率。结果测量显示,受影响的左上肢(LUE)改善了80 - 100%。除肩部内旋和外旋外,徒手肌力测试评分恢复至正常范围,握力、捏力和精细运动协调性虽有改善但仍有限。定性数据强调了在OT干预中考虑PTS的社会文化视角和心理社会影响的重要性。本研究报告了这种罕见病症的OT干预措施及结果。所有结果测量均显示有改善,许多在正常范围内。考虑患者的社会文化和心理社会影响似乎有助于改善结果。
